Output 80ba5834b7971f35f5dfec919e13ba9d20dd0a135ec34182eb3cc50cef42c724:1

value
586928
script pubkey
OP_0 OP_PUSHBYTES_20 89c101f9dad315e1777b6f0444e063fbb5c0f266
address
bc1q38qsr7w66v27zammduzyfcrrlw6upunxqgw4hr
transaction
80ba5834b7971f35f5dfec919e13ba9d20dd0a135ec34182eb3cc50cef42c724
spent
true